Jackie Chan Biography

Born on Hong Kong’s Victoria Peak on April 7th, 1954, Jackie Chan is a versatile artist known for his work as an actor, martial artist, film director, producer, and stuntman. Since the 1960s, he has acted in over 150 films and has been estimated to have a net worth of $350 million by Forbes magazine in 2015. Apart from his acting talents, he is also a gifted singer.

Chan’s parents, Charles and Lee-Lee Chan, were refugees from the Chinese Civil War. As a child, Chan was nicknamed Pao-pao and joined the China Drama Academy at the age of six to learn music, dance, and martial arts. At the age of 17, he began working as a stuntman in the Bruce Lee films Fist of Fury and Enter the Dragon, using the stage name Chan Yuen Lung. He also starred in the comedic adult film All in the Family in 1975.

Chan’s talents led him from being a stunt player to a stunt director. He was inspired to create a new style in martial arts-based films after the death of Bruce Lee, who was a world-famous martial arts legend at the time. Chan’s breakthrough film was Snake in the Eagle’s Shadow in 1978, which was followed by Drunken Master, propelling him to mainstream success. The Big Brawl was his first Hollywood film in 1980. The Young Master, Project A, Armour of God, and Dragon Lord are some of his earlier Chinese hits. Chan’s most successful films include Shanghai Noon and Shanghai Knights with Owen Wilson, Rush Hour trilogy with Chris Tucker, and the epic film The Forbidden Kingdom, in which he starred with Jet Li.

Jackie Chan’s 1980 directorial debut “The Young Master” revolutionized martial arts films, leading him to Hollywood. Most of his movies have been box office hits, including “Police Story,” “New Police Story,” “Rush Hour” (1, 2, and 3), “Drunken Master,” “Forbidden Kingdom,” and many more. He always performs his own stunts.

In 1982, Chan tied the knot with Taiwanese actress Joan Lin, and they welcomed their son, singer and actor Jaycee Chan, the same year. He also had a daughter in 1999 as a result of an extramarital affair. Along with Jet Li and Bruce Lee, he is considered one of China’s greatest actors.

Chan is a true maverick in the international film industry, as an actor, director, stuntman, and producer. He has persevered through hard work and determination to achieve his dreams of becoming an international cinematic star
